Calculate time taken for consolidation in actual layer, Civil Engineering

Assignment Help:

A clay layer 5 m thick has double drainage. It was consolidated under a load of 127.5 kN/m2. The load is enhanced to 197.5 kN/m2. The coefficient of volume compressibility is 5.79 × 10-4 m2/kN and value of k = 1.6 × 10-8 m/min. Determine total settlement and settlement at 50% consolidation. If the test sample is 2 cm thick and attains 100% consolidation in 24 hours, what is the time taken for 100% consolidation in the actual layer?
